| Add 3.0 uL Cy3 or Cy5 to respective primer-annealed RNAs.
|
|
| Aliquot 11.6 uL of RT cocktail to each rxn for total volume of 30 uL.
|
|
| Incubate 2 hr @ 42C. Place on ice.
|
| 4.
| Place 500 uL TE (pH 7.4) each in two microcon-30 filters.
|
|
| Add RT rxns to each microcon filter. Centrifuge 7 min. at top speed.
|
|
| Optional: Repeat TE washes 1-2 times, or until all unincorporated dye is removed.
|
| 5.
| Inspect filters. Centrifuge in 30 sec. intervals until volume is 10-20 uL.
|
| 6.
| Invert filters into fresh tubes. Centrifuge 1 min. to harvest labeled cDNA.
|
|
| Optional: For next day hybridization, store cDNA @ 4C.
|
| 7.
| Mix together Cy3- and Cy5-labeled cDNAs.
|
|
| Concentrate sample to ~10-12 uL using microcon filter or vacuum pump.
|
| 8.
| Add 1 uL polyA DNA or RNA for non-specific hybridization.
|
|
| Add 3 uL 20X SSC for total volume of 12-15 uL.
|
| 9.
| Pre-wet millipore filter by adding 5 uL ddH2O. Centrifuge 1 min. at top speed.
|
|
| Remove eluted water with pipet tip.
|
| 10.
| Add probe to filter. (Pipet probe onto filter wall, not directly onto membrane.)
|
|
| Centrifuge 1 min. at top speed.
|
| =>
| PROBE IS NOW READY FOR HYBRIDIZATION.
|
|
| REMEMBER TO ADD 0.3 uL SDS (10%) TO PROBE as stated in hybridization protocol. |
